Transaction 80d327fc446cc28caabd05c089ead07d0ff6800a0112856ec60914831c0f80ad

1 Input
2 Outputs
  • 80d327fc446cc28caabd05c089ead07d0ff6800a0112856ec60914831c0f80ad:0
  • value  21772262
    address  146W4uK8KMrHjTSozngL5DKYWuySkji2tk
  • 80d327fc446cc28caabd05c089ead07d0ff6800a0112856ec60914831c0f80ad:1
  • value  1945143307
    address  1FKGa8s6bUEX961SUXfvwaZHn1vkGUZ3VM